Giants hopes of a double look strong as final four is in their sites/ Flyers shoot down stars to make history...


The playoffs are really hotting up now! Only five EIHL teams remain in this years playoffs and season as a whole. On Sunday, there were only two games, that meant a lot!

   Hull Stingrays attempted a comeback against Belfast Giants and the three goal aggregate score, which looked impossible to come from, shockingly became one in the second period as Stingrays lead 2-0. But as Giants have done all season, they went on to win 3-2 and 7-3 on aggregate to qualify once again for finals weekend!

Giants opponents for Saturdays semi-final would be decided in a crucial game between Dundee Stars and Fife Flyers. Stars had nearly come from behind the previous night as at one point they were down 4-0 but the Gardiner conference champions closed that gap to 4-3 on the night making Sunday a massive showdown! Stars gave their all on their final home game this season but Flyers heroics got them a 4-1 victory meaning a 8-4 final aggregate score would get them their first playoff weekend appearance since returning to top flight action!
